怎么做呢,输入:abcde输出:12345


Scanner scanner = new Scanner(System.in);
String s1 = scanner.nextLine();
char []c1=s1.toCharArray();
for (char c:c1) {
System.out.print((int)c);
}

输出:979899从ASCII

我要12345

我们知道字母a的ASCII码是97,对于b是98,…,所以要得到1的a,然后你可以从它减去96,现在的解决方案应该是;

int i = c - 96;
System.out.print(i); // 12345

相关内容

  • 没有找到相关文章

最新更新